Output e668ae0ec23f85c90047a04926e53a4176f2d4f5c2a8d0856c64e1bc2236c743:1

value
7988513
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 553856afd0a345302fed838b30c8a1e2f0d3070d6591a307e9eb665deaf08bcf
address
bc1p25u9dt7s5dznqtldsw9npj9putcdxpcdvkg6xplfadn9m6hs308st96p8z
transaction
e668ae0ec23f85c90047a04926e53a4176f2d4f5c2a8d0856c64e1bc2236c743
spent
true